As we previously reported, customizing master sillof (Jamie Follis) will be hosting a customizing panel at Star Wars Celebration on Friday, April 17th from 12pm-1pm. Some more details about the panel have been posted at his site.
This will be the second time that Jamie has headed up this event, and if you are going to be at C7, you ought to make an effort to attend. Work from some of the Yakface forum members you are familiar with will be featured in this panel, including some custom figure giveaways!

Preorders are now open for A New Proof: Kenner Star Wars Packaging Design 1977-1979 by Mattias Rendahl. This must-have book for vintage fans is limited to only 500 copies and features full-color imagery as well as interviews with the design team responsible for developing the signature Kenner line look. You can check out sample pages of the book at dearpublications.com.
For Celebration Anaheim attendees, Mattias will be having a panel on this book Sat., April 18, 1:30–2:30PM on the Collectors Stage (210AB)

Gus Lopez and Duncan Jenkins have announced their next book in there expanding catalog of titles: Gus and Duncan’s Guide To Star Wars Micro Collection Toys. It will be available for purchase at Celebration Anaheim and online order will launch tomorrow (4.8.2015).
